Output 58e3f714c2b0635c6585ab3b33958af685effce8c6e0553a8489ab98a923a594:1

value
452000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3accb22a676043ba8e3094278289b2bedd7f5b1 OP_EQUALVERIFY OP_CHECKSIG
address
1PDSCX1nMiZUps8UZecbE7amkBovShcb3o
transaction
58e3f714c2b0635c6585ab3b33958af685effce8c6e0553a8489ab98a923a594
spent
true